*Gingerbread Men

This is a really great recipe for ginger-bread biscuits, they have a lovely rich flavour, and are not too gingery...(add more ginger if you want a stronger ginger flavour).You Will Need
225g/8oz plain flour
½ tsp ground ginger
½ tsp ginger-bread spice
½ tsp bicarb. of soda
75g/3oz butter
2 tbsp golden syrup
1 tbsp black treacle 55g /2oz soft light brown sugar
20g/1oz oz dark muscavado sugar
1 tbsp water
50g/2oz icing sugar (to decorate)



MethodThe oven should be set to 180°C/350°/gas 4, and two baking trays need to be greased. You will need a cooling wrack.
Sift together the flour, spices & bicarbonate of soda in a bowl. Place the butter, syrup, treacle, sugar & water in a saucepan over a low heat. Heat gently till the butter has melted & all the sugar dissolved. Cool for 5 minutes.
Pour syrup into the flour mixture and blend to a soft dough. Leave covered for 30 minutes before rolling out to about 3mm thick. Cut into shapes with a cutter and place on the baking trays. Bake for about 10 minutes till golden.
Mix the icing sugar with enough water to make a thick paste and decorate with a piping bag or cocktail stick.
